The CSTO Secretary General had a meeting with the Armenian Foreign Minister

31.08.2021

On August 30, this year, the Collective Security Treaty Organization Secretary General Stanislav Zas had a meeting with the Armenian Foreign Minister Ararat Mirzoyan, who was in Moscow on a working visit.
In the course of the meeting Stanislav Zas and Ararat Mirzoyan discussed the dynamics of changes in the military and political situation at the regional and international levels, that has a direct impact on the vital interests of the CSTO member States. The sides also discussed the situation on the Armenian-Azerbaijani border and stressed the need for its speedy resolution.

Ararat Mirzoyan noted that during its upcoming presidency in the CSTO the Republic of Armenia would make active efforts to develop and strengthen the Organization's potential.

In turn, Stanislav Zas assured that the CSTO Secretariat would make all necessary efforts to promote the priorities of the Armenia's upcoming presidency in the Organization.
